Mountain Arts Center presents the Appalachian Strings & Things at Jenny Wiley Amphitheater

Prestonsburg, Ky. – The MAC will produce the inaugural Appalachian Strings & Things on July 2-3 at Jenny Wiley Amphitheater. It’s described as a mix of old, new, traditional, and progressive Bluegrass music, with some acoustic stylings thrown in. The music festival is being presented with help from Prestonsburg Tourism and Floyd County Tourism.

On Friday July 2, the headliner will be industry veterans Mountain Heart. Also on the bill that night will be multiple IBMA award winners Rob Ickes & Trey Hensley. Saturday, July 3 includes Sideline and rising Kentucky based band Wolfpen Branch.

For full lineup info and more information, check out the MAC, Jenny Wiley Amphitheater’s, and Appalachian Strings & Things social media pages. Ticket prices start at $30. To purchase log onto www.macarts.com, call 888-MAC-ARTS, or stop by the Box Office.

The Mountain Arts Center is the premier performing arts venue in eastern Kentucky.  Located in the heart of the bloodline of the Country Music Highway, the facility features a 1,046-seat auditorium, conference/meeting facilities, instruction rooms and a state-of-the-art recording studio.  For more information, call 1-888-MAC-ARTS or visit macarts.com.
